ACTOR Lee Sun-kyun, best known for his role in the Oscar-winning film Parasite, has reportedly been found dead in a park in Seoul.
Sun-kyun, 48, was being investigated for suspected drug use at the time of his death.

A man in his 40s was found in a car in Seoul, South Korea at 10:30 am on Wednesday, according to The Korea Times.
Police later identified the unconscious man as Sun-kyun.
Earlier in the day, police received a report from the actor’s family that a suicide note was found at his home and began to search for him.
Sun-kyun was being investigated on suspicion of using marijuana and other illegal drugs, the outlet reported.

He was accused of partaking in illegal drugs at the home of a high-end bar hostess multiple times since the beginning of the year.
Sun-kyun claimed that the hostess tricked him into doing the drugs, according to The Korea Times.
The actor tested negative for drugs in two recent tests, according to the outlet.
Before his death, Sun-kyun went through three rounds of police questioning.

The actor was seen publicly on December 23 while arriving for questioning in the suspected drug use case.
Sun-kyun played Dong Ik in the hit film Parasite, which won the 2020 Oscar for Best Picture.
Parasite became the first foreign language film to ever win the coveted category.
In addition to Parasite, Sun-kyun was known for his work in the 2014 action film A Hard Day and the 2009 drama Paju.
He also starred in 12 episodes of the 2023 crime series Payback, playing the main character Eun Yong.
